what sucks is when people try to copy Datsik to an extreme amount.

talk about boring ryhtyms! these datsik posers are a joke.

seckle is correct, everyone just wants attention, the biggest problem is COPYCAT shit.

i hate when i hear a sick intro and then the drop is like the exact same tough guy rhythm as every other formula-based tune.

take the first 4 bars of a drop,

3 bars repeated and then on the 4th bar staccato the 2 3 and 4 beat of the last measure.

CORNY CORNY shit!!

i got into dubstep cuz the rhythms on the drops would blow my mind cuz i didnt see shit coming.

nothing more i hate than datsik posers :? :?

BE ORIGINAL, come from the heart, have a purpose behind your music.

yargh.

that being said,

i dont think "Hardstyle" is a bad way to describe harder dubstep.

richie august is original as hell, his synths sound fucking awesome! but i dont want his tunes to be degraded by people posing his sound.

personally i LOVE heavy heavy shit, because i WAS into grindcore type shit, and still do love it, and also because it sounds SICK on a soundsystem.

it is hard to switch between dubstep styles tho when mixing, you have to find very creative solutions.

and another thing, radio is so much different than playing out its not even funny.

@yong - stop being a weiner about it tho would ya? yeesh. :roll: you sound like a pansy no offense.

i think people need to do a lot of old interview reading on the net, have a knowledge about where this sound came from, who created it, what the ethics were etc.

and i think mala still says it best when he says each artists, each soundsystem should be judged on its own merits eg. DMZ Sound, Yong Sound, Richie August Sound, ABZ Sound, etc etc etc etc.

i for one appreciate it all.

He doesnt go to many shows, but I know what he's saying... you dont have to go to shows to understand whats going on. Im getting pretty tired of every tune at a "dubstep" show sounding like every tune did at a "dnb" show 4 years ago.

I was one of the people in the "nah, its all dubstep, innit" camps for the longest time, but Im sorry... theres just too damn much music with too many influences now.

These threads remind me of this hypothetical conversation...

"I listen to rock".
"Oh really, what kind of rock? Punk, metal, pop, grunge, lo-fi, indie?"
"Nah mate, I said I listen to rock, you know, rock... with guitars."
"Right, right, I get that... but what kind do you like the most?"
"What you mean, like the most... I like it all, I listen to it all... its all just rock..."
"Ok then, who do you like?"
"Oh right... I Tool, Killswitch Engage, Mastadon... "
"So you like metal?"
"NO YOU TWAT, I LIKE ROCK! ROCK! DONT YOU GET IT? ITS ALL ROCK, IT DONT NEED NO SUBGENRES!!!"

There is such a diverse range of styles represented in this wonderful music that all falls under the umbrella term of 'dubstep' that there needs to be a bit more distinction, if only for the ease of discussion and to be sure you know what you're getting into and paying your money for.

Look at house... theres what? 25+ different styles of house? But they're all recognizable as house, and classifying it into different catagories hasnt hurt the genre, not in the least.

All this ambiguity is only confusing matters IMO.
